《完整版学生成绩管理系统数据库》由会员分享,可在线阅读,更多相关《完整版学生成绩管理系统数据库(21页珍藏版)》请在金锄头文库上搜索。
1、学生成绩管理系统数据库一、需求分析阶段1.信息需求,大大高校学生的成绩管理工作量大、繁杂,人工处理非常困难。学生成绩管理系统借助于计算机强大的处理能力,实现了学生成绩管理的自动化,不仅,而且对学生成绩的判断和整减轻了管理人员的工作量,并提高了处理的准确性。学生成绩管理系统的开发运用把广大教师从繁重的成绩管理工作中解脱出来、把学校从传统的成绩管理模式中解放出来 理更合理、更公正,同时也给教师提供了一个准确、清晰、轻松的成绩管理环境。2. 功能需求能够进行数据库的数据定义、数据操纵、数据控制等处理功能,进行联机处理的相应时间要短。具体功能应包括:系统应该提供课程安排数据的插入、删除、更新、查询;成
2、绩的添加、修改、删除、查询,学生及教职工基本信息查询的功能。3. 安全性与完整性要求二、概念结构设计阶段概念结构设计阶段是整个数据库设计的关键,它通过对用户需求进行综合、归纳与抽象,形成一个独立于具体DBMS的概念模型。设计教室管理数据库包括班级、教室、课程、教师四个关系。E-R图如下课程选课教师性别教师信息表学生信息表课程倍息去一教课教师系别教师名学号学号成绩r1课程号21 or sage21结果:H结果消息sname departJ,障琦1 一同2 崔雪娇Lra3 董朝阳数学丢4 杜鹃计算机系5 方卉文法系(7) 查询所有学生的平均年龄select avg(sage) as平均年龄from Student1结果:J结果均年龄B.连接查询学生的学号、姓名,所选课程的课程号、课程名和成绩、任课教师名,teacher1.tnameSe